Block 580,343
Block Hash
2c4dd3de0f19535762029396bb747e7fb0f7becc1387fb8e3ab692fc84e062dc
Previous Block Hash
9268e6d6f09c6da0e0f3fdbd0ebf010799fefbbd7fb62fdd9da2786b49085367
Mined
Transactions
3
Difficulty
25.12 M
Size
623 bytes
Transactions (3)
1 input, 1 output
15,625.00452
PEPE
1 input, 2 outputs
28,847.85152
PEPE
1 input, 2 outputs
18,948.00034
PEPE